About the role
Apex manufactures scalable satellite buses to support the growing demand for commercial space infrastructure. You will manage the full lifecycle of our satellite operations, from initial mission planning and commissioning to real-time monitoring and anomaly resolution.
Key facts
What you'll do
- Create and verify mission plans and operational documentation for flight hardware.
- Manage the operational roadmap and processes for a specific satellite bus product line.
- Oversee spacecraft commissioning during the launch and early orbit phases.
- Perform real-time satellite monitoring, including fault detection, safing, and recovery procedures.
- Design and implement fault protection and automation strategies for ground and onboard systems.
- Evaluate telemetry data to track spacecraft performance and mission outcomes.
- Partner with engineering staff to troubleshoot anomalies and enhance system reliability.
- Establish standardized operational protocols across all spacecraft programs.
- Prov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ior staff members.
Requirements
- U.S. Person status is mandatory for access to export-controlled data.
- Bachelor degree in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, or a related discipline.
- Minimum of 3 years of hands-on mission operations experience, specifically in commissioning, mission planning, and anomaly resolution.
- Programming proficiency in C++, Rust, or Python.
- Background in testing, integrating, and validating distributed or real-time systems.
- Deep technical knowledge of spacecraft subsystems such as avionics, communications, and propulsion.
- Experience with mission operations software and telemetry automation tools.
- Familiarity with satellite operations platforms like GMAT or STK.
- Ability to make high-stakes decisions and solve problems under pressure.
- Strong interpersonal skills for team collaboration and customer interactions.
